### Garagewatch occupancy feed

The occupancy feed for the Loxbury garages arrives every 30 seconds over the ingest bridge. If counts stall, check the bridge consumer before restarting the publisher, since restarts reset stall-detection timers and can mask the real fault. Each payload is signed; the verifier rejects anything older than two minutes. Verification requires the feed's public signing key, shown below.

signing key of bagap-yawep = bky13_TbfT6ZMUoGJo2

## Account Recovery — Trailnote Offline Mode

When a surveyor's Trailnote app has been offline for 30+ days, their local credentials expire and sync refuses to resume. Don't make them wipe the device — all their unsynced field data lives there! Instead, open the support console, pick "Offline Reinstate," and enter their handle. The console will ask for the support team's shared recovery passphrase before issuing a reinstatement token. Use the one below.

unlock words, bagaf-fajeg: zorael-kelax-fraath-quenix-eliok-sileth-aldmir-wenir-druiel

## Deploying the Gatewick Proctor Queue

Deploys are pretty painless: push to main, wait for the pipeline, then watch the queue drain dashboard for five minutes. If candidates pile up mid-exam, roll back first and ask questions later — the queue replays safely. Everything the workers care about lives in one config block, shown here for reference.

settings of bafof-yagef:
JOROX_PIN=8740
JOROX_TENANT=pelox
JOROX_METRICS_HOST=metrics.jorox.qorvelworks.internal
JOROX_SEAL=seal_c78f63c1
JOROX_STANDBY_TEAM=norax

# Service Accounts — Vramlens GPU Profiler

The Vramlens memory profiling toolchain runs under the `vramlens-agent` service account on all training hosts in the Calder cluster. Support staff should not create personal tokens; the shared agent account is the only identity permitted to push allocation traces to the Heapharbor ingest service. If a customer host stops reporting, verify the agent is running before escalating to the Foundry team. For manual trace uploads during an investigation, authenticate with the key shown below.

app token of yajeg-kawef = kto11_7En3XSX8xQw